Monsebroten, MSCTC men edge Marauders
Published Monday, February 12, 2007
The Minnesota State CTC Spartan men grabbed a huge win Saturday afternoon after Dustin Monsebroten stole the ball on an inbounds pass, was fouled, and made two free throws in a 69-67 win over Minneapolis.
A three-point shot Scott Stebe drained with 46 seconds left set up the Monsebroten steal to win the game.
Jason Speer led the team in scoring with 16. Monsebroten was right behind with 15.
Ziro Novalath led the Marauders with 18.
MSCTC held a 34-26 edge on the boards. Speer grabbed nine.
The Spartans will travel to Willmar Wednesday for an 8 p.m. game with Ridgewater.
